67 usage = "usage: %prog [options] command\nCommands: "+ (', '.join(known_commands))
68 parser = optparse.OptionParser(prog=usage)
69 parser.add_option("-g", "--gui", dest="gui", help="User interface: qt, lite, gtk or text")
70 parser.add_option("-w", "--wallet", dest="wallet_path", help="wallet path (default: electrum.dat)")
71 parser.add_option("-o", "--offline", action="store_true", dest="offline", default=False, help="remain offline")
72 parser.add_option("-a", "--all", action="store_true", dest="show_all", default=False, help="show all addresses")
73 parser.add_option("-b", "--balance", action="store_true", dest="show_balance", default=False, help="show the balance of listed addresses")
74 parser.add_option("-l", "--labels", action="store_true", dest="show_labels", default=False, help="show the labels of listed addresses")
75 parser.add_option("-f", "--fee", dest="tx_fee", default=None, help="set tx fee")
76 parser.add_option("-F", "--fromaddr", dest="from_addr", default=None, help="set source address for payto/mktx. if it isn't in the wallet, it will ask for the private key unless supplied in the format public_key:private_key. It's not saved in the wallet.")
77 parser.add_option("-c", "--changeaddr", dest="change_addr", default=None, help="set the change address for payto/mktx. default is a spare address, or the source address if it's not in the wallet")
78 parser.add_option("-s", "--server", dest="server", default=None, help="set server host:port:protocol, where protocol is t or h")
79 parser.add_option("-p", "--proxy", dest="proxy", default=None, help="set proxy [type:]host[:port], where type is socks4,socks5 or http")
80 parser.add_option("-v", "--verbose", action="store_true", dest="verbose", default=False, help="show debugging information")
81 parser.add_option("-P", "--portable", action="store_true", dest="portable", default=False, help="portable wallet")
82 parser.add_option("-L", "--lang", dest="language", default=None, help="defaut language used in GUI")
83 parser.add_option("-u", "--usb", dest="bitkey", action="store_true", help="Turn on support for hardware wallets (EXPERIMENTAL)")
